Interview With the Vampire 

If you want to know what magic Anne Rice created with a pen and multiple sheets of paper, there’s no better text to review than The Vampire Chronicles series, starting with the first book in the series, and her glittering career as well, Interview with The Vampire.

Interview with The Vampire is such a widely acclaimed book that it granted Anne Rice an immediate impact in the literary world. It’s known for its thrilling storytelling and mesmerizing depiction of shock, suspense, love, loss, danger, and the eroticism that comes with the daily lives of vampires.

Thanks to the huge success of this text, Anne Rice began writing sequels to it during the 1980s leading to the birth of The Vampire Chronicles. In 1994, the book was also adapted into a movie of the same name.

Blood and Gold 

We doubt you haven’t noticed already, but we might as well tell you that tales of vampires and their thrilling existence are the driving forces behind the best Anne Rice books. And Blood and Gold is no different from what you’ve read so far.

Blood and Gold gives readers a sneak peek into the life and tales of Marius, one of the oldest vampires there ever was, from his origin in ancient Rome to the contemporary days when he encounters another supernatural creature, this time born of snow and ice.

Lasher 

What happens when you’re held captive by a brutal but somehow irresistible demon with dreamlike powers? If you’re the queen of the coven, Rowan Mayfair, you find a way to escape. But we all know these things are easier said than done, especially when the demon in question, Lasher, can draw both the queen and innocent readers in with twilights and hypnotic stories.

Rather than just hoping for the queen’s escape, readers will surprisingly find themselves curious about the aspirations and passions of the supposed bad guy in Lasher.

Servant of the Bones 

Moving on, this next text takes the readers back in time, as far back as the Old Testament days. It starts with a murder on modern-day fifth-day avenue in New York but soon after, readers find themselves centuries back in time. And what’s more, they get to experience the heroism of Azriel through the thrilling storytelling of one of Anne Rice’s best books.

What are the arcane mysteries of the Kabbalah? What went on in the Fall? What’s the true nature of good and evil? If you’re up for a revisit to the Old Testament world to find these out and more, grab yourself a copy of Servant of the Bones.

Prince Lestat and the Realms of Atlantis: The Vampire Chronicles 

Like all thrilling stories Anne Rice told, this list has to come to an end. And in typical Rice fashion, we’ll end our written work with a look into the rich and gothic world of The Vampire Chronicles; this time , with a look at the 12th book in the 15-book series.

This book takes readers for a dive into the great power that thrived for centuries in the great Atlantic Ocean. We’re talking about Atalantaya, the Realms of Atlantis, the great powers that have been considered benign by the vampires for years, and how Lestat and all vampires have to deal with this terrifying force, centuries after its great fall.
